Impakt Posted March 15, 2004 Share Posted March 15, 2004 Hello everyone, I have recently built a device for the stock nissan ecu. Attached is a (crappy) picture taken with my phone. It plugs into the Consult diagnostic port and displays 8 sensors in realtime. This means that CA18 vehicles will not work with this as they dont have a consult port. The sensors/data it can display are: rpm speed afm voltage injector pulse width injector duty cycle coolant temp ignition timing tps voltage absolute tps position (%age) EGT voltage (if supported by ecu) o2 sensor voltage AAC position (%age) battery voltage Lean/Rich Indicator Flags (On/off indicators for: Closed TPS, A/C Relay, A/C Compressor, Fuel pump, start switch, VTC solenoid, thermo fans, and a few others. The device also has a serial port so you can connect your laptop to it and potentially log the data. You can also read the stock maps from the ecu with a laptop. And no, you cant tune the ecu with this! It also has a peak-hold function, so it will remember the max rpm, duty cycle, pulse width, afm voltage, water temp etc, and store it in memory for recall later... Impakt Posted March 17, 2004 Author Share Posted March 17, 2004 What i meant was that the consult port on its own does not work once a power FC is used. Obviously the power fc has the interface there to be able to monitor and change these bits of data.
